“THIS WEEK IN MXA WITH JOSH MOSIMAN?” NEW RUBBER, STEEL GRATES, CARBON BIKE, TRIPLE CLAMPS & JOSH’S THREE NATIONAL BIKES

The 2023 AMA National Motocross Championship series starts this Saturday at Pala Raceway, and Motocross Action’s Assistant Editor, Josh Mosiman, is planning to race the first three rounds on three different brands for an MXA test. In this video, Josh highlights the new addition of metal starting grates for the outdoor races and  tests the new Maxxis tires and Luxon MX’s new Gen-3 triple clamps for the 2023 Yamaha YZ450F. Also, Dennis Stapleton and Trevor Nelson split away from he MXA gang and went to the Dunlop MX34 tire intro (which was 100 miles away for the Maxxis intro at a different track on the same day). We also share an interview with Dunlop’s Chris Siebenhaar, explaining the details of the new MX34 tires. Additionally, Josh talks all about the new Motocross Action Fantasy League for the AMA National Motocross series and climbs a narrow country road on the Swiss-made Thomus Sliker road bike that he’s using for AMA National training—ignoring the panting, it’s hard to climb and talk at the same time.
